Empowering Veterans with Aerial Robotics: Skydio's 2024 Scholarship Expansion

With great excitement, we are pleased to announce that the Skydio Veteran Aircraft Scholarship program will be returning and expanding in 2024! Building on the accomplishments of the campaign in previous years, we are continuing our support for our veterans by providing them with opportunities to enhance their careers through the use of autonomous drone technology.

Through the Skydio Veteran Aircraft Scholarship program, we will be distributing Skydio 2+ Pro Kits to select recipients. Mission of the Scholarship:

The goal of the Skydio Veteran Aircraft Scholarship is to give veterans skills and training that will help them pursue established professions in the civilian sector. A Skydio 2+ Pro Kit will be provided to the recipients of the scholarship. This kit will include a subscription to our Skydio Autonomy Enterprise for a period of one year, the ability to perform 3D scans, and access to our online Skydio Training Academy for a period of ninety days.

How to Apply:

Individuals who are interested in applying for the scholarship are required to submit a personal essay or a video/presentation no longer than 800 words or 3 minutes in length, in which they share their story and describe how they intend to use the drone to advance their careers in the civilian sector. Skydio's own veteran community will review the submissions and select the scholarship recipients.

The deadline to submit is August 31, 2024.
